BB what goes into your green smoothie?
But the most basic is: handful of spinach (or any other green leaf), a banana and 240 ml water.
Mine today has a few more ingredients: a large handful of chard and pakchoi, roughly chopped and into liquidiser, one carrot more finely chopped, celery, a banana and a pear chopped and 500ml water.
You can add more fruit to sweeten: it should be sweet enough to be enjoyable: the purpose of the fruit is to counterbalance the green veg.
I also throw in a few flax seeds and the contents of a green tea teabag but they are extras.
This makes about a litre which I drink 500ml at a time.
Any green leaves will do: spinach, cabbage, spring greens etc. It's good to vary what you use if doing them regularly. You also don't have to have the carrot and celery. I just enjoy the variety.
I find it a great way to double the veg I am eating: and raw is extra benefitcial in the vits and mins. It also means if I am having a meal that traditionally doesn't have loads of veg, I don't have to worry as I am still eating plenty in between and they are nice and filling too.I try to take one day at a time, but sometimes several days attack me at once0 -
